Union debaters will move out of their Chess Room home grounds on Quincy Street and invade neighboring areas shortly, when the Yard's Debating Society completes current negotiations for inter-school contests against teams within a 30-mile radius.
Following an organizational meeting two weeks ago, the group, which now boasts 40 members, began a series of weekly intra-society debates on Wednesdays at 7:30 o'clock. The first session took place Wednesday, when craters tackled the problem of military conscription.
Werner Pieus '51 is the newly-elected secretary of the Society. He is assisted by Dimitri d'Arbeloff '51. Graduate Advisers are William Reeb '44 21, and Frank L. Broderick 2G.
